AS A FRESHMAN IN 2017-18
Sat in the bow of the varsity four boat that advanced to the grand finals at the IRA National Championship regatta … Was in the bow of the varsity four boat that finished fourth competing against openweight competition at the Dad Vail Regatta … Was in the bow of the varsity four boat that finished fifth at Eastern Sprints, defeating crews from Wisconsin and Georgetown … Was in the one seat of the 4x that defeated Harvard and MIT in the Lightweight Beanpot … Sat in the bow of the lightweight 8 “B” boat that competed against openweight crews and finished third in the Knecht Cup petite final …  Sat in the bow of the second varsity eight boat that fell to Stanford in a duel race on the Charles River … Sat in the bow of the second varsity eight boat that competed at the Head of the Housatonic Regatta in Derby, Conn., finishing 17th in a field of 23 openweight boats … Was in the one seat of the lightweight four “A” boat that finished fifth at the Head of the Charles Regatta. 

BEFORE BOSTON UNIVERSITY
Attended Berkeley High School in Berkeley, Calif. ... Rowed for Oakland Strokes club team.
